Motivation
The process that initiates, guides, and maintains goal-oriented behaviors, driving individuals to pursue and achieve objectives.
Need-Based Theory
A motivational theory suggesting that behavior is driven by an individual's desire to fulfill unmet needs, ranging from basic survival needs to complex psychological needs.
Fixed Ratio Schedules
A reinforcement strategy in which a response is rewarded only after a specified number of responses, used in various contexts, including behavioral psychology.
Reinforcement Theory
A theory in psychology that suggests behavior is motivated by its consequences, with reinforcement used to increase or decrease specific behaviors.
